Topics Covered
- Introduction to Generative Models: Foundational concepts of generative models and their applications in data augmentation.
- Generative Adversarial Networks (GANs): Understanding GANs and their role in data augmentation for deep learning models.
- Variational Autoencoders (VAEs) and Normalizing Flows: Exploring VAEs and normalizing flows for data augmentation in machine learning.
- Data Augmentation Strategies for Vision Tasks: Applying generative models to data augmentation for computer vision tasks.
- Data Augmentation for Natural Language Processing (NLP): Using generative models for data augmentation in NLP applications and tasks.
- Implementation and Evaluation of Generative Models: Practical implementation and evaluation of generative models for data augmentation.
